#3af808 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3af808 is composed of 22.7% red, 97.3%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.8%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 107.5 degrees, a saturation of 94.5% and a lightness of 50.2%. #3af808 color hex could be obtained by blending #74ff10 with #00f100. Closest websafe color is: #33ff00.

#3af808 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3af808 has RGB values of R:58, G:248,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0, Y:0.97,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 3864584.
